Добавить в корзинуПозвонить
Найти в Дзене
Миша Ларченко

Почему архитектура сейчас важнее кода

🧐 Команда AI-агентов работает ровно настолько хорошо, насколько хорошо продумана архитектура. Если архитектуры нет - ЛЛМ начнет галлюцинировать / додумывать за вас. В конечном итоге создаст систему, которая не выдержит роста. Либо не запуститься вовсе. 👥 Команда агентов просто выполнит план так, как ему дали: монолит, REST через 10 запросов, одна база для всего - без учёта масштабирования и долговечности. Если есть архитектура - у ЛЛМ есть инструкция и понимание того, что вы хотите получить от нее и какие инструменты использовать: Вы получите продукт, который можно масштабировать и развивать без переписывания. 📁 Архитектура - это план системы: - Как разделены сервисы - Какие базы отвечают за разные типы данных - Как общаются компоненты По каким принципам пишется код ИИ пишет код за часы. Но переписать плохую архитектуру - значит построить систему заново. Раньше можно было исправлять разработчика по ходу работы. Агенты устроены иначе: они точно выполняют план. Плохой план →

Почему архитектура сейчас важнее кода 🧐

Команда AI-агентов работает ровно настолько хорошо, насколько хорошо продумана архитектура.

Если архитектуры нет - ЛЛМ начнет галлюцинировать / додумывать за вас. В конечном итоге создаст систему, которая не выдержит роста. Либо не запуститься вовсе.

👥 Команда агентов просто выполнит план так, как ему дали:

монолит, REST через 10 запросов, одна база для всего - без учёта масштабирования и долговечности.

Если есть архитектура - у ЛЛМ есть инструкция и понимание того, что вы хотите получить от нее и какие инструменты использовать:

Вы получите продукт, который можно масштабировать и развивать без переписывания.

📁 Архитектура - это план системы:

- Как разделены сервисы

- Какие базы отвечают за разные типы данных

- Как общаются компоненты

По каким принципам пишется код

ИИ пишет код за часы. Но переписать плохую архитектуру - значит построить систему заново.

Раньше можно было исправлять разработчика по ходу работы.

Агенты устроены иначе: они точно выполняют план.

Плохой план → быстрый технический долг.

Поэтому от разработчика теперь требуется не скорость печати, а понимание архитектуры и правильное мышление.

Важно

- Понимать, когда система должна делиться на независимые сервисы

- Выбирать технологии под задачу

- Проектировать простые и устойчивые решения

- Задавать правила, по которым агенты будут строить продукт

Команда агентов - это мощный инструмент 🧰

Но пользоваться этим инструмент нужно уметь. Все зависит от знаний подходящих инструментов и архитектурных навыков разработчика, который им управляет.

🔥 — если хотите видеть чаще постов про тонкости работы с ЛЛМ и то как их использую я.